Come and experience this exhilarating surf camp at KoHola Surf! Located in Peniche, famous for the reason that there is a dozen of various surf spots stretched on only a few kilometers of the coast, you can always find your own wave on one of them. KoHola surf offers beginner, intermediate, and advanced surfing lessons to suit your needs. Book now and enjoy the best surfing spots in Portugal!
The surf house has five guest rooms for two to six persons, a fully equipped kitchen, and three bathrooms. In the lounge area, you can relax reading a surfing magazine, watching TV or DVD, surfing on free Wi-Fi internet, or just hang out with the rest of the guests on the terrace in the back of the house.
The surf lessons are going to be held by experienced Portuguese instructor in English and each day, he will take you to the spot with the best conditions for your surfing skills. Wave quality depends on wind and swells directions, tides, the size of the waves, and at the end it as well as depends on the potential crowd factor. Your instructor will take care to avoid crowds and find ideal conditions to catch your first waves. Peniche and surroundings are the best regions for surfing in Portugal because of the dozen surf spots situated on a relatively short stretch of the coast.
Peniche is situated on a peninsula surrounded by long sandy beaches on both of its sides. Peniche area is famous for the reason that there is a dozen of various surf spots stretched on only a few kilometers of the coast, so you can always find your own wave on one of them. With the ocean, beaches, and waves from your dreams all around you, you’ll quickly get used to the surf lifestyle and if you are too tired to surf all day, you can travel around and get to know better this beautiful country. You can go on a day trip to Lisbon, explore towns and the coast around Peniche (Obidos, Nazare, etc.), and go to the nature reserve on the Berlengas. If you want to check nightlife after surfing, you will find a few good nightclubs and bars or beach bars in Baleal where you can party until the first morning light.

Please book your flight to arrive at Lisbon Portela Airport (LIS). Transfer from and to the airport is available at an additional cost of approx 20 - 60 EUR (depends of number of guests) each way.
Cheapest way to come from Lisbon to Peniche is by bus (approx. 10 EUR).
